TL;DR Summary

A timelapse video captured the short but impressive life cycle of a phallic mushroom known as the stinkhorn fungus. The mushroom, resembling a penis, emerges from balls that hang around like human genitalia. The mature fungus bursts forth at a rapid rate, covered in a green-brown jelly that smells like rotting corpses. This adaptation helps the fungus disperse its spores through carrion-feeding flies and other invertebrates. The video shows the mushroom attracting flies before collapsing down in a flaccid heap, successfully dispersing its spores for further growth.
